Exercise 78
In the following sentences he, his, they, their, them, it, or its should be inserted. Give the reason for your choice.
1. No man is allowed to leave —— desk untidy.
2. Every one must put —— tools away before leaving the shop.
3. Every office worker is required to be in —— place at eight-thirty every morning.
4. In my business a person must learn to make up —— mind quickly.
5. It was cold this morning. Every one wore —— wraps.
6. Every clerk must do —— own work.
7. If an employee has ideas for the improvement of the business, —— is requested to report —— suggestions to the superintendent.
8. The superintendent is anxious to have every workman feel that —— (has, have) a definite place in the organization, and that if —— (does not, don't) do —— work, the business will suffer.
